Output badc6bb9393771d44502d5995e7625fa72da28d2fc1288695bf3f2731368f0fb:0

value
963044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5249e00b148f701157f89325580591555d645b2f OP_EQUAL
address
39C7qDAegxboitkct3J1brg9S6ftZtWp8D
transaction
badc6bb9393771d44502d5995e7625fa72da28d2fc1288695bf3f2731368f0fb
confirmations
333398
spent
true